I figured it was Bob again who forgot to tell me something.&nbsp; But it was assistant Sara, and I could tell she had been crying.&nbsp; As bad as the discovery of the leak in my kitchen was, my Saturday morning was about to get worse.<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"color: #ff0000;\">Saturday the 10th \u2013 SADDER DAY! \u2013<\/span> Before I picked up the ringing house phone I checked the caller ID and saw that it was Sara. It was odd that she didn\u2019t call my cellphone.&nbsp; After a quick check I saw that she had tried my cell phone but the ringer was off.&nbsp; As soon as she spoke I could tell she had been crying. She said, \u201cTurn on the news.\u201d&nbsp; I feared the worst.&nbsp; I asked her what was going on and she said, \u201cAdam West died.\u201d&nbsp; I didn\u2019t say anything.&nbsp; I was just talking about Adam extensively last week as the \u201cLady Dynamite\u201d session.&nbsp; We were just at the Smokehouse last night, one of Adam\u2019s favorite dinner places.&nbsp; Then in a flash, it all started to make sense.&nbsp; A few days ago my agent sent me an audition from a studio who was looking for somebody to voice-match Adam for some unfinished lines he needed to record for an animated TV show.&nbsp; They said he wouldn\u2019t be available to record his ADR (additional dialogue recording) in time for the show to be mixed, and they had his blessing to find a suitable replacement.&nbsp; That struck me as odd because, as long as I\u2019ve known Adam he\u2019s always taken his work very seriously.&nbsp; He would do whatever he needed to do to make sure the job was done and done right. Looking for a voice-match for Adam just didn\u2019t sit right with me.&nbsp; As Batman would say it was \u201codd\u2026very odd.\u201d&nbsp; I checked the internet and details were continuing to pour in.&nbsp; The last time I saw him he was at his agent Fred Westbrook\u2019s memorial at the Smokehouse last November.&nbsp; We were just there last night, right around the time he passed away.&nbsp; Was it fate\u2019s way of allowing us an unknowing tribute? I had to make the call to Scott Sebring who was busy at a photo shoot.&nbsp; I always hate making those calls, but I wanted him to hear it from me before he heard it on the news.&nbsp; You can read my tribute to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.wallyontheweb.com\/home\/adam-west-tribute\/\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Adam West and our 37 year friendship HERE\u2026<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Under the circumstances, I sent out new movie night invites pre-empting \u201cA Dog\u2019s Purpose\u201d in favor of an Adam West retrospective.&nbsp; I didn\u2019t get to bed until noon.&nbsp; I got up at 3 with lots to do.&nbsp; Edi was back from her hair appointment and we got some groceries for movie night.&nbsp; We started the evening with an episode of \u201cThe New Adventures of Batman\u201d starring Adam as the voice of Batman.&nbsp; Then we watched his \u201cLove American Style\u201d episode, his \u201cOuter Limits\u201d episode, and then we watched the documentary \u201cStarring Adam West.\u201d&nbsp; Not only was it nice seeing Adam in the film, but our old friend Fred Westbrook as well.&nbsp; Many of our movie night crew was featured in the film, myself included.
